Link libraries and queues

NetTree separates where sources live from what you commit to a site. Three layers work together for backlink source library management and directory submission list hygiene.

Public library (Plaza)

Path: /app/plaza

Plaza is NetTree’s product directory library — directories, launch platforms, communities, and content-publish destinations with fit signals and ops remarks.

What to review before adding

  1. Relevance — category, language, region vs your site profile
  2. Risk — payment, editorial gate, UGC policy
  3. Submission endpoint — whether a real submit URL exists
  4. Ops remark — curator notes (English where available)

Add to site queue

From a Plaza card, add the source to a site submission queue. The item enters queued or moves toward draft_ready once a workflow draft exists.

Free plans see 10 visible sources on Plaza (no pagination or filters). Paid plans unlock pagination, filters, and — on Pro/Business — personalized recommendations.

CSV import

Path: /app/library/import

Upload a CSV to bulk-add private sources. Required columns depend on the import panel template — typically domain, name, and optional notes.

Imported rows count toward maxPrivateSources on your plan. See Workspace settings — plans.


Site submission queue

Path: /app/sites/[id]/queue

The queue is the commitment list for one site — every row is a destination you chose to pursue.

Queue statuses

StatusMeaningTracker Operation (when visible)
queuedAdded; draft not startedNot in Tracker yet
draft_readyDraft prepared; ready to submitPending
submittedYou marked submit completeSubmitted
liveTreated as published/live in queuePublished
rejectedStopped pursuingRejected
skippedDeprioritizedSkipped

Open a row to enter the matching workflow (directory, guest post, comment, or content publish).

Bulk actions

From the site queue toolbar you can:

  • Open selected — open up to 10 submit/homepage URLs in new tabs
  • Generate drafts — bulk AI draft generation for selected rows

To deprioritize a destination, use Skip inside a workflow workbench. Skipped rows may show Reopen in Submission Tracker.


Batch open from site queue

Path: /app/sites/[id]/queue

Select rows, then Open selected to launch up to 10 destination URLs in separate tabs. You still complete each submission manually on the third-party site.

This replaces a legacy Quick Open route; there is no standalone /app/quick-open page in the current app.

Common questions

Can I add the same domain twice? NetTree merges Tracker rows by site + source domain + target domain. Avoid duplicate queue rows for the same destination when possible.

I skipped a source — can I retry? Yes. Reopen from Tracker or restore from the site queue if still listed.

Where do admin “Link Source” fields appear? Curators maintain intelligence in admin; operators see user-safe Plaza cards and ops remarks — not internal scoring drafts.
